AN ACT 1 Amending Titles 24 (Education) and 71 (State Government) of the 2 Pennsylvania Consolidated Statutes, providing additional 3 supplemental annuities commencing 2001. 4 The General Assembly of the Commonwealth of Pennsylvania 5 hereby enacts as follows: 6 Section 1. Title 24 of the Pennsylvania Consolidated 7 Statutes is amended by adding a section to read: 8 § 8348.6. Supplemental annuities commencing 2001. 9 (a) Benefits.--Commencing with the first monthly annuity 10 payment after July 1, 2001, any eligible benefit recipient shall
1 be entitled to receive a further additional monthly supplemental 2 annuity from the system. This shall be in addition to the 3 supplemental annuities provided for in sections 8348 (relating 4 to supplemental annuities), 8348.1 (relating to additional 5 supplemental annuities), 8348.2 (relating to further additional 6 supplemental annuities), 8348.3 (relating to supplemental 7 annuities commencing 1994), 8348.4 (relating to special 8 supplemental postretirement adjustment) and 8348.5 (relating to 9 supplemental annuities commencing 1998). 10 (b) Amount of supplemental annuity.--The amount of the 11 supplemental annuity payable pursuant to this section shall be a 12 percentage of the amount of the monthly annuity payment on July 13 1, 2001, determined on the basis of the most recent effective 14 date of retirement, as follows: 15 Most recent effective date Percentage 16 of retirement factor 17 July 2, 1999, through July 1, 2000 1.86% 18 July 2, 1998, through July 1, 1999 3.59% 19 July 2, 1997, through July 1, 1998 4.95% 20 July 2, 1996, through July 1, 1997 6.42% 21 July 2, 1995, through July 1, 1996 7.97% 22 July 2, 1979, through July 1, 1995 10% 23 July 2, 1969, through July 1, 1979 20% 24 On or prior to June 30, 1969 25% 25 (c) Payment.--The supplemental annuity provided under this 26 section shall be paid automatically unless the annuitant files a 27 written notice with the board requesting that the additional 28 monthly supplemental annuity not be paid. 29 (d) Conditions.--The supplemental annuity provided under 30 this section shall be payable under the same terms and 20010H1533B2288 - 2 -
1 conditions as provided under the option plan in effect as of 2 July 1, 2001. 3 (e) Benefits to beneficiaries or survivors.--No supplemental 4 annuity provided under this section shall be payable to the 5 beneficiary or survivor annuitant of a member who dies before 6 July 1, 2001. 7 (f) Funding.--Notwithstanding section 8328 (relating to 8 actuarial cost method), the additional liability for the 9 increase in benefits provided in this section shall be funded in 10 annual installments increasing by 5% each year over a period of 11 20 years beginning July 1, 2001. Notwithstanding the provisions 12 of section 212 of the act of April 22, 1998 (P.L.1341, No.6A), 13 known as the General Appropriation Act of 1998, regarding 14 payment for cost-of-living increases for annuitants, payments 15 for cost-of-living increases for annuitants shall be made under 16 section 8535 (relating to payments to school entities by 17 Commonwealth). 18 (g) Eligible benefit recipient.--As used in this section, 19 the term "eligible benefit recipient" means a person who is 20 receiving a superannuation, withdrawal or disability annuity on 21 July 1, 2001, and whose most recent effective date of retirement 22 is prior to July 1, 2000, but the supplemental annuities 23 provided under this section shall not be payable to an annuitant 24 receiving a withdrawal annuity prior to the first day of July 25 coincident with or following the annuitant's attainment of 26 superannuation age. 27 Section 2. Title 71 is amended by adding a section to read: 28 § 5708.6. Supplemental annuities commencing 2001. 29 (a) Benefits.--Commencing with the first monthly annuity 30 payment after June 30, 2001, any eligible benefit recipient 20010H1533B2288 - 3 -
1 shall be entitled to receive a supplemental monthly annuity from 2 the system. This shall be in addition to the supplemental 3 annuities provided for in sections 5708 (relating to 4 supplemental annuities), 5708.1 (relating to additional 5 supplemental annuities), 5708.2 (relating to further additional 6 supplemental annuities), 5708.3 (relating to supplemental 7 annuities commencing 1994), the special supplemental 8 postretirement adjustment provided for in sections 5708.4 9 (relating to special supplemental postretirement adjustment) and 10 5708.5 (relating to supplemental annuities commencing 1998). 11 (b) Amount of supplemental annuity.--The amount of the 12 supplemental annuity payable pursuant to this section shall be a 13 percentage of the amount of the monthly annuity payment on July 14 1, 2001, determined on the basis of the most recent effective 15 date of retirement, as follows: 16 Most recent effective date Percentage 17 of retirement factor 18 July 2, 1999, through July 1, 2000 1.86% 19 July 2, 1998, through July 1, 1999 3.59% 20 July 2, 1997, through July 1, 1998 4.95% 21 July 2, 1996, through July 1, 1997 6.42% 22 July 2, 1995, through July 1, 1996 7.97% 23 July 2, 1979, through July 1, 1995 10% 24 July 2, 1969, through July 1, 1979 20% 25 On or prior to June 30, 1969 25% 26 (c) Payment.--The supplemental annuity provided under this 27 section shall be paid automatically unless the annuitant files a 28 written notice with the board requesting that the additional 29 monthly supplemental annuity not be paid. 30 (d) Conditions.--The supplemental annuity provided under 20010H1533B2288 - 4 -
1 this section shall be payable under the same terms and 2 conditions as provided under the option plan in effect as of 3 July 1, 2001. 4 (e) Benefits paid to beneficiaries or survivors.--No 5 supplemental annuity provided under this section shall be 6 payable to the beneficiary or survivor annuitant of a member who 7 dies before July 1, 2001. 8 (f) Funding.--Notwithstanding section 5508(e) (relating to 9 actuarial cost method), the additional liability for the 10 increase in benefits provided in this section shall be funded in 11 annual installments increasing by 5% each year over a period of 12 20 years beginning July 1, 2001. 13 (g) Eligible benefit recipient.--As used in this section, 14 the term "eligible benefit recipient" means a person who is 15 receiving a superannuation, withdrawal or disability annuity on 16 July 1, 2001, and whose most recent effective date of retirement 17 is prior to July 1, 2000, but the supplemental annuities 18 provided under this section shall not be payable to an annuitant 19 receiving a withdrawal annuity prior to the first day of July 20 coincident with or following the annuitant's attainment of 21 superannuation age. 22 Section 3. This act shall take effect immediately. D9L24MRD/20010H1533B2288 - 5 -
